On Saturday night Canelo Alvarez successfully defended his super middleweight title against Edgar Berlanga. The war ended up being as complete and utter a conflict as many expected it to be.

Canelo was simply too smart, too skilled, too cunning, too consistent, and too experienced for Berlanga. To his credit, Berlanga put in a valiant and admirable effort, but he was no match for Canelo.

Since losing to Dmitry Bivol back in May 2022, Canelo hasn’t been involved in many fan-friendly fights. The most interesting matchup was his third fight against Golovkin, but at that time GGG was growing and sliding. After that win, Canelo beat Jon Ryder, 154-pound champion Jermell Charlo, Jaime Munguia, and most recently won against Berlanga.

After his victory over Berlanga, on DAZN radio they suggested three reasonable options for Canelo’s next opponent: Terence Crawford, Dmitry Bivol and David Benavidez.

Benavidez is a fight that many fans have wanted for years now, but for various reasons it never came together, and that seems unlikely to change anytime soon. A potential rematch against Bivol is something Canelo has expressed interest in, as long as Bivol wins his upcoming October 12 fight with Artur Beterbiev for the undisputed light heavyweight title. A fight between Canelo and Crawford is something that Turki Al-Sheikh expressed interest in, until he lost interest after hearing Canelo’s demands, but this is a fight that Crawford still wants despite the fact that he has never fought at 160 let alone 168, and Crawford only had one fight at 154.
